Grasping Business Registration
Corporate registration refers to the process by which companies formally document their presence with the designated state bodies. This procedure typically involves submitting various forms and records that highlight important information about the corporation, such as its designation, contact information, objective, and the identities of its directors and stakeholders. Proper filing is vital, as it guarantees lawful recognition of the corporation and compliance with state plus local regulations.
The corporate filing process can change significantly depending on the jurisdiction and the particular requirements of the company. Companies are often obligated to provide initial creation documents, as well as ongoing reports known as yearly submissions. These documents keep the business in positive reputation and provide openness to governing authorities. It is important for company owners to comprehend the deadlines associated with these filings to steer clear of any fines or breaks in regulation.

The Corporation Registration Process
This business filing process becomes critical for establishing your company legally. This procedure typically starts with choosing a distinct name for your corporation that adheres with state regulations. After selecting a name, you must to create and submit the necessary formation documents, often called documents of formation, with the relevant state agency. These documents contain essential information about the corporation, such as its structure, purpose, and the registered representative responsible for receiving legal correspondence.
After the documents of formation are filed, you can receive a notice from the state, indicating that your company is officially recognized. At this stage, it is crucial to obtain an Employer Identification Number (EIN) from the IRS, which is necessary for taxation purposes and hiring employees. You will need to establish corporate bylaws, which outline how your corporation will operate, including the responsibilities of directors and officers, meeting procedures, and decision-making methods.
After completing these steps, ongoing adherence is required to maintain your company's good status. This entails filing annual reports, paying necessary fees, and complying to local regulations. Common Corporate Submission Mistakes
One of the most common mistakes businesses make during corporate filing is failing to fulfill specific state requirements. Each jurisdiction has specific rules regarding paperwork, forms, and costs that must be submitted. An additional common error is overlooking critical filing timelines. Companies must comply with multiple schedules for initially required filings, annual reports, and modifications. Missing these deadlines can result in fines, late fees, or the termination of the business in certain cases. Organizations should create a schedule or set reminders for key dates to guarantee timely adherence with all submission requirements.

Corporate Compliance and Filing Requirements
Navigating corporate compliance and filing obligations is crucial for any business aiming to operate legally and effectively. Corporations must adhere to state and federal laws, which often involve submitting specific papers within designated timelines. These submissions can include articles of incorporation, annual reports, and tax papers. Failure to comply can lead to penalties, closure, or other legal consequences, making it imperative for business proprietors to stay informed about their obligations.
Understanding the business filing procedure is the first stage to guaranteeing compliance. Generally, this procedure involves gathering necessary documents, filling out corporation filing forms correctly, and sending them to the appropriate state authorities.
